https://xamarin.com redirected to https//dotnet.microsoft.com during the time we crawled it. Xamarin is a software company that was founded in 2011 and acquired by Microsoft in 2016. It provides a platform for building mobile applications using C# and .NET. Xamarin's main product is Xamarin.Forms, which allows developers to create native user interfaces for iOS, Android, and Windows using a single, shared codebase. Xamarin's approach to cross-platform mobile development has several advantages: 1. **Native Performance**: Xamarin apps are compiled to native code, which means they can achieve the same performance as apps developed using platform-specific languages and tools. 2. **Code Reusability**: With Xamarin.Forms, a significant portion of the code can be shared across different platforms, reducing development time and effort. 3. **Access to Native APIs**: Xamarin provides bindings for native APIs, allowing developers to access platform-specific features and functionality. 4. **Large Community and Ecosystem**: Xamarin has a strong community of developers and a rich ecosystem of third-party libraries and tools. 5. **Integration with Visual Studio**: Xamarin integrates seamlessly with Microsoft's Visual Studio IDE, providing a familiar and powerful development environment for C# developers. 6. **Support from Microsoft**: As a part of Microsoft, Xamarin benefits from the resources and support of a major technology company. Xamarin has been widely used by developers and organizations to create mobile applications, including both consumer-facing apps and enterprise solutions. It has gained popularity for its ability to streamline the development of cross-platform mobile apps while maintaining a high level of performance and native user experience. In summary, Xamarin is a reputable and widely used platform for cross-platform mobile development, particularly for C# developers and organizations that want to leverage their existing skills and investments in the .NET ecosystem. Its acquisition by Microsoft has further solidified its position in the industry, and it continues to be a popular choice for building mobile applications across different platforms."
